Step 1

              Blade               
  • The case screw can easily be removed by using a Stanley #2 screwdriver or any other #2 screwdriver.

The case screw can easily be removed by using a Stanley #2 screwdriver or any other #2 screwdriver.

Step 2

  • Separate casing by simply pulling apart both halves.

Separate casing by simply pulling apart both halves.

Step 3

  • Carefully, using the pull tab, take out the blade holder and set it on the table.
  • Remove the blade by carefully sliding it out of the holder.

Step 4

  • Replace the old blade with the new blade by carefully sliding it into the blade holder.
  • Place the blade holder back into the casing using the pull tab to hold it.

Step 5

  • Add grease to the sliding mechanism
  • Use either a paper towel or a cloth to spread the grease around the sliding mechanism.

Step 6

  • Take the other half without the blade and put it back together with the other half with the blade.
  • Snap the two parts together.
  • Place the screw back in to hole while holding the casing together.

Step 7

  • Use Stanley #2, or any other #2, screwdriver to screw the casing back together.
  • To ensure proper placement of the blade, activate the mechanism that slides the blade out.
  • Once it comes out, like in second picture, you are done.
